Patent number: 10185496Abstract: A reception-side apparatus determines whether or not data duplicating a part of received data from a transmission-side apparatus is stored in the first storage that stores first data which has been received, and notifies, when data duplicating a part of the received data is stored in the first storage, the transmission-side apparatus of prediction information on duplicate reception of the first data. A transmission-side apparatus compares, when the prediction information is received, second data to be transmitted and a part of the first data in a second storage that stores the first data which has been transmitted based on the prediction information, determines whether or not there is a first part of the first data matching the second data in the second storage, and transmits, when there is the first part of the first data in the second storage, outline information on the second data.Type: GrantFiled: February 22, 2017Date of Patent: January 22, 2019Assignee: FUJITSU LIMITEDInventors: Shinichi Sazawa, Hiroaki Kameyama

Patent number: 9602753Abstract: A solid-state imaging apparatus includes: a comparator comparing a signal output from pixels with a reference signal of which level changes dependent on time; a plurality of first bit storage units and a plurality of second bit storage units holding, bit by bit, a count signal of the plurality of bits from a counter, according to a write control signal based on a result of the comparing by the comparator; and a control unit arranged between the comparator and the first and second bit storage units, and adjusting a delay time of the write control signal. An order of lengths of the delay time of the count signal held by the first and second bit storage units is the same as an order of lengths of the delay time of the write control signal of the first and second bit storage units.Type: GrantFiled: February 10, 2015Date of Patent: March 21, 2017Assignee: CANON KABUSHIKI KAISHAInventors: Kazuhiro Saito, Hiroaki Kameyama, Kohichi Nakamura
